So, here's what I did with the potatoes:
First I sliced up the potatoes, threw them in a bag with the following: 

  • 1.5 tsp of ext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/2 tsp garlic salt
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 3/4 tsp sugar

Then I cooked them at 425°F for 17 minutes total (I flipped them after 10 minutes and then cooked them for another 7). I still managed to burn them because I'm just that talented. But, they were awesome!
So, I will definitely be making these again, but I will be tweaking the cook time a bit so they stop burning. I'm also considering using parchment paper rather than aluminum foil to make these fries a bit more crispy. I also had some strawberries that were awesome since I got them at the farmer's market.
